Honda Cb500X
When it comes to finding an adventure bike that’s both capable and affordable, it’s hard to beat the Honda CB500X. This versatile machine is perfect for everything from commuting to light off-roading, and its low price tag makes it a great option for budget-minded riders.
The CB500X is powered by a 471cc twin-cylinder engine that produces 47 horsepower and 32 lb-ft of torque.
That might not sound like much, but the CB500X is surprisingly nimble thanks to its lightweight chassis. It also features a number of upgrades over the standard CB500F model, including longer suspension travel, larger wheels, and more aggressive tires.
If you’re looking for an adventure bike that won’t break the bank, the Honda CB500X should be at the top of your list.

Cb500X Vs Tenere 700
When it comes to choosing an adventure bike, there are many factors to consider. But one of the most important is what size engine you want. That’s why we’re comparing the CB500X and Tenere 700 – two popular models with different engine sizes.
The CB500X has a 471cc engine, while the Tenere 700 has a 689cc engine. Both are liquid-cooled, four-stroke engines with DOHC and four valves per cylinder. The CB500X produces 47 horsepower at 8,500 rpm and 32 lb-ft of torque at 7,000 rpm.
The Tenere 700 produces 72 horsepower at 9,000 rpm and 53 lb-ft of torque at 6,750 rpm.
So, what does that mean for performance? The CB500X will get you from 0 to 60 mph in about 5 seconds, while the Tenere 700 will do it in about 3.9 seconds.
And when it comes to top speed, the CB500X is capable of reaching 112 mph, while the Tenere 700 can hit 124 mph.
So, which one is right for you? If you’re looking for a bike that’s more powerful and faster, then the Tenere 700 is the way to go.
But if you’re looking for something that’s more economical and easier to ride on city streets or back roads, then the CB500X might be a better option.
